Cleaning Your iPhone 13 Mini

The first step is a deep clean. Use a soft, lint-free cloth to wipe down the exterior. For stubborn dirt or smudges, lightly dampen the cloth with water or a screen-safe cleaner. Avoid harsh chemicals that can damage the screen or casing.

Don’t forget to clean the charging port, speakers, and buttons using a soft brush or compressed air. This ensures your device looks well-maintained and functions properly.

Optimizing Software and Settings

Reset your device to factory settings to remove personal data and give the new owner a fresh start. Backup important data beforehand. To do this, go to Settings > General > Reset > Erase All Content and Settings.

Ensure your iPhone is running the latest iOS version for optimal performance. Also, disable Find My iPhone and sign out of iCloud to prepare for the sale.

Final Tips Before Selling

Take clear, well-lit photos of your cleaned and refurbished iPhone 13 Mini from multiple angles. Highlight its condition and any new parts or accessories included.

Write an honest and detailed description of the device’s condition, recent repairs, and included accessories. Transparency builds trust and can help you sell faster.
